[Armadillo:00478] Re: atmark-distについて
Yuuya Shigei
email@hidden
2005年 9月 1日 (木) 15:59:27 JST
ルートファイルイメージを開発マシンでマウントし、romfsの中を確認してみま
したが、原因がよくわかりませんでした。 しかし、以下の方法で起動すること
ができました。
-------------------------------------------------------------------
1. 付属のCD内の uClinux-dist-20041228でmakeする
2. make image の箇所で
genext2fs: too many arguments
というエラーが出て、images ディレクトリに linux.bin のみが出来る
(これがuClinux-dist から atmark-dist に変えた理由です)
3. uClinux-dist-20041228/romfs を atmark-dist-20050729/romfs にコピーす
る
4. atmark-dist-20050729 ディレクトリで make image を実行すると
atmark-dist-20050729/images に romfs.img が出来る
5. 2で出来た linux.bin と、 4で出来た romfs.img を圧縮してフラッシュに
書き込む
---------------------------------------------------------------------
とりあえずですが、これで起動できました。
>
> 森島です
>
> そうですか、、
> それならば、
>
> 1. ルートファイルイメージがFlashメモリのユーザーランド領域に
> 書き込まれていない
>
> 2. ルートファイルイメージが壊れている
>
> 3. ルートファイルイメージ内に /sbin/init が存在しない
>
> あたりでしょうか。
>
> 2 と 3 に関しては、開発用のマシン上で、
> # mount -o loop romfs.img /mnt
> などとしてマウントし、中身を確認する事ができます。
>
>
>
> >ルートファイルシステムはオンボードflashに格納しています。
> >ブートパラメータとはブートオプションのことでしょうか、もしそうで
> >あればデフォルトです。
> >-------------------------------------------------------------
> >
> >
> >>森島です
> >>
> >>init を見つけれていないようです。
> >>以下の点を教えてもらえますか。
> >>1. ルートファイルシステムを置いているデバイス
> >>2. カーネルのブートパラメータ
> >>
> >>
> >>
> >>
> >>>はじめまして重井と申します。
> >>>
> >>>現在、armadiilo9のAC97CODECを認識させるためにatmark-distでOSをクロ
ス
> >>>コンパイルしたいと思っています。しかし、make menuconfigで設定をデ
フォル
> >>>トにしてmakeしてできるイメージファイルでarmadillo9を起動すると、
カーネ
> >>>ルがパニックを起こしてしまいます。
> >>>こちらでは原因をなかなか特定できず困っています。 よろしければご意見
を
> >>>お聞かせください。
> >>>また、AC97CODECの認識のためのmenuconfigの設定方法をご存知の方がい
らっ
> >>>しゃるならば、教えていただけると幸いです。
> >>>こちらの環境は以下の通りです。
> >>>開発マシン:RedHat9
> >>>ディストリビューション:atmark-dist-20050729
> >>>linux :linux-2.4.27-a9-6
> >>>armadilloのサポートページで配布されているツールは
> >>>"uucp-1.06.1-944.i386.rpm"以外すべてインストールしています。
> >>>"uucp-1.06.1-944.i386.rpm"はインストール中にlibdb-3.1.soパッケージ
を
> >>>見つけられないというエラーメッセージが出てうまくいきませんでした.
> >>>
> >>>パニック時には以下のように出力されました。
> >>>Kernel panic: No init found. Try passing init= option to kernel.
>
>>>--------------------------------------------------------------------
> >>>初心者の質問で恐縮ですがよろしくお願いいたします。
> >>>
> >>>
armadillo メーリングリストの案内